
Superior University, through the Social Entrepreneurship Program (SEP) under the Chaudhry Muhammad Akram Centre for Entrepreneurship Development, organised a Rashan Distribution Drive as part of the Ramazan Campaign 2026, in collaboration with Allah Wale Foundation.
The drive was conducted at Government Girls Primary School, Raiwind, where ration bags were distributed among deserving families, ensuring timely support for those in need during the holy month of Ramazan.
The activity was graced by Dr Usman Sadiq, Program Director SERP & Sustainability, who visited the site, appreciated the efforts of the organising team, and encouraged students for their commitment to community service and social impact.
